Gumenchuk Vasyl

Multimedia technologies in information and library service of users with visual impairment: research methodology

Abstract: Problem formulation. The disclosure of the moral and intellectual potential of Ukrainian society is facilitated, on the one hand, by democratization and, on the other hand, by the European vector of Ukraine’s development and focus on universal values. The presence of theoretical developments in Ukrainian library science on the peculiarities of servicing users with visual impairments and significant practical experience in this area raises the issue of methodological tools of the study. The purpose of the article is to characterize the methodological tools of research of multimedia technologies in information and library services for visually impaired users. Scientific novelty. Traditional and innovative methodological approaches in modern library science (structural-functional, activity, marketing, technological, institutional, process, synergetic, cognitive, socio-cultural) are revealed, was defined actual methods for modernization of research of multimedia technologies as a component of information-library service for visually impaired in terms of the introduction of modern information and communication technologies and global digitalization of society. Such approaches as system-structural, social, historical, socio-communicative are characterized. Conclusions. The main theoretical and methodological approaches to the study of information and library services for visually impaired users are: system-structural, social, historical, sociocommunicative, activity and process approaches. Modern methodological tools for studying the functioning of libraries for the blind in order to successfully meet their information needs and educational, scientific and cultural needs allows us to study ILS as an open a multilevel subsystem of the library as a space for information, training and meeting places, focused on providing and expanding the range of various information services and services with a comprehensive combination of access to different types and kinds of information.

Keywords: library, information and library service, audio resource, visually impaired users.
